Calculadora de Bytes em Texto
Conversor de Unidades ▲
Conversor de Unidades ▼
From: | To: |
Calcular o tamanho de uma string em bytes é essencial no contexto de armazenamento e transmissão de dados, especialmente com a prevalência de sistemas de armazenamento e comunicação digitais. Esta calculadora ajuda a determinar o tamanho em bytes do texto de entrada, o que é crucial para otimizar soluções de armazenamento, largura de banda da rede e compreensão das eficiências de codificação.
Histórico
O conceito de medir o tamanho de dados em bytes tornou-se significativo com o advento da tecnologia de computadores. Como os computadores processam e armazenam informações digitalmente, entender a quantidade de dados em termos de bytes é crucial para eficiência e otimização tanto no desenvolvimento de software quanto na transmissão de dados.
Fórmula de cálculo
O tamanho de uma string em bytes depende da sua codificação. Para a codificação UTF-8, que é amplamente usada devido à sua compatibilidade com ASCII e sua capacidade de representar qualquer caractere no padrão Unicode, o cálculo pode variar porque o UTF-8 usa de 1 a 4 bytes para cada caractere:
\[ \text{Bytes} = \text{comprimento da string codificada em UTF-8} \]
Exemplo de cálculo
Para uma string "Hello, World!", assumindo a codificação UTF-8:
- A maioria dos caracteres nesta string são ASCII e usará 1 byte cada.
- O total de bytes seria 13, pois há 13 caracteres, todos ASCII.
Importância e cenários de uso
Entender o tamanho em bytes das strings é vital em muitas áreas, incluindo desenvolvimento de software, onde impacta o uso de memória e desempenho, e em desenvolvimento web, onde afeta os tempos de carregamento de página e utilização da rede.
Perguntas frequentes comuns
-
Por que o tamanho em bytes de uma string é importante?
- O tamanho em bytes impacta os requisitos de armazenamento, largura de banda da rede para transmissão e desempenho. Otimizar o tamanho em bytes pode levar a aplicativos e sistemas mais eficientes.
-
Como a codificação de caracteres afeta o tamanho em bytes?
- Codificações diferentes representam caracteres com diferentes números de bytes. Por exemplo, ASCII usa 1 byte por caractere, enquanto UTF-8 pode usar de 1 a 4 bytes por caractere, dependendo do caractere.
-
Posso calcular o tamanho em bytes para qualquer string com esta calculadora?
- Sim, esta calculadora pode processar qualquer string de entrada e calcular seu tamanho em bytes com base na codificação UTF-8.
Esta ferramenta fornece uma maneira fácil de medir o tamanho em bytes das strings, facilitando a melhor compreensão e tomada de decisão em relação ao tratamento de dados e ao design de aplicativos.